In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les (2003) the Rat King (who is never referred to as such and voiced by David Zen Mansley) appears in the episode "I, Monster", which is an adaptation of his first appearance in the Mirage Comics. Instead of dying like in the comics, the Rat King survives the fall into the silo after his fight with Leonardo.

Powers and abilities[]

Being a prototype super-soldier created from the DNA of various species including but not limited to Bishop, Splinter, and the Ninja Turtles, the Rat King's physical attributes are above average. He was strong enough to go up against the Turtles and endured being electrocuted and falling from a great height. He has an accelerated healing factor allowing his wounds to heal in a matter of seconds. As a result of him having combat knowledge uploaded into his brain by Bishop, he is a master hand-to-hand combatant and skilled enough to take on multiple opponents at once and even managed to take Raphael's sais from him in battle. He was able to become invisible, allowing him to perform sneak attacks on his opponents. It is assumed that this is a result of the technical components attached to his body (which where damaged after he was electrocuted), as he did not posses this power during his second encounter with the Turtles. He seems to be able to communicate or has some form on control over rats, likely as a result of Splinter's DNA being a part of his genetic code.
